Summary

On 18 November 1983 at about 20:23 local time, a Bell 47-G registered N64816, operated by Brett Aviation, was involved in an accident near Middle River, Maryland, United States. 2 people were on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. No probable cause statement is available for this record.

Read the full NTSB narrative

WHILE PRACTICING HOVERING ABOUT 2 FT AGL THE STUDENT ALLOWED THE HELICOPER TO START DRIFTING AFT & RIGHT. THE RIGHT SKID HEEL CONTACTED THE GROUND & THE HELICOPTER ROLL ONTO ITS RIGHT SIDE.

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record.
